About Us

Mama’s Garden is a small, family-run farm located in the South Fork Valley of Deming, Washington. Built on over 20 years of hard work and shared vision, our farm is operated by three women—Kim, Kelly, and Renee—each bringing different strengths together to create something rooted in trust, honesty, and community.

We raise and produce a variety of farm goods including fresh eggs, grass-fed beef, seasonal produce, and Big Leaf maple syrup. Everything we offer is handled with care and intention, from how our animals are raised to how our products are harvested, processed, and shared. We believe in doing things the right way —not the fastest or easiest way—and that shows in the quality of the food we provide.

At the heart of Mama’s Garden is a commitment to transparency. We believe people should know where their food comes from and who is behind it. Our farm stand operates on an honor system, reflecting the trust we place in our community and the relationships we’ve built over time.

We are also deeply connected to our local food system. In addition to our own products, we support and collaborate with other local farms and producers, helping create a network where small farms can grow together rather than compete. We believe there is room for everyone at the table.

For us, farming is more than a business—it’s a way of life. It’s raising food we are proud to feed our own families and sharing that with our community. 

At Mama’s Garden, our goal is simple: to provide honest food, grown with care, and rooted in something real.


Practices

At Mama’s Garden, our farming practices are rooted in simplicity, transparency, and doing things the right way—even when it requires more time and hands-on work. We are a small, family-run farm, and our egg production reflects a commitment to quality over quantity. 

Our flock is cared for every single day, without exception. Eggs are collected daily to ensure freshness, and our chickens are checked multiple times throughout the day for health, safety, and overall well-being. This hands-on approach allows us to stay closely connected to our animals and quickly respond to any changes.

We provide our hens with a consistent, quality feed to support their health and egg production, while also allowing them to supplement their diet through natural foraging. This balance contributes to the rich, nutrient-dense eggs we are known for. 

Our maple syrup production is rooted in patience, stewardship, and a deep respect for the natural rhythms of the Pacific Northwest. Harvesting Big Leaf Maple syrup is not about control—it’s about working with nature, paying attention, and showing up every day to do things the right way.
